Web3时代的鉴权机制:未来互联网的安全筑基
引言:Web3的到来
说实话,当我第一次听到“Web3”这个概念时,脑子里就炸了。一开始,搞不清楚这是个啥意思,只是模糊听说和区块链、去中心化、数字身份有关系。但随着时间推移,逐渐了解,Web3其实是一个全新网络的构想,强调用户的自主权和隐私保护。这可是个大趋势,像潮水一样,一波波涌来。
什么是鉴权?
说到鉴权,很多小伙伴可能会想:对,我知道这个!就是确认你是谁,验证你是否有权限去做某些事情。比如,你登录某个网站时,输入用户名和密码,系统就会判断你的身份。简单来说,鉴权就是让网络知道你是谁,以及你能干什么。
Web3的独特之处
在Web3的世界里,传统的鉴权方法已经不够用了。这是因为Web3强调的是去中心化。想象一下,之前我们常用的很多第三方平台,比如Facebook、Google,都是中心化的,所有数据都在他们的控制下。现在,这种形式逐渐被打破,用户的数据安全、隐私保护和自主权都被提上了日程。
Web3的鉴权机制
那么,Web3到底是怎么进行鉴权的呢?实际上,Web3的鉴权方式主要有以下几种:
- 公钥/私钥机制:在Web3中,用户会生成一对密钥:公钥和私钥。公钥就像你的银行账号,任何人都能知道;而私钥则是你的密码,只有你自己知道。用公钥对某个信息加密后,只有用私钥才能解密。这种方式让身份验证变得安全又去中心化。
- 智能合约:在区块链上,智能合约自动执行一些协议,无需中介。想获取某种权限,智能合约验证你是否符合条件,直接决定是否让你通过。比如说,你想参与某个DeFi项目,智能合约会检测你的代币余额,如果满足条件,立马给你权限。
- 数字身份:Web3允许用户创建数字身份,用户可以在不同的平台上认同自己。有些项目还会用去中心化身份(DID)系统,记录你的身份信息,确保隐私。
公钥/私钥机制的优势和缺点
说实话,公钥/私钥机制是Web3中最基础也是最重要的身份验证方式。它简单又高效,但也有不足之处。你想啊,私钥如果丢了,就意味着你失去了对你资产的控制权。这可真是个危险的事!我见过不少人,因为私钥丢失而损失惨重。小伙伴们一定要好好保管自己的私钥,能用硬件钱包更好。
智能合约的运作原理
而智能合约呢,真的是个有趣的东西。它不仅能验证身份,还能自动执行既定规则。比如,一个DeFi项目的流动性挖矿,参与者需要先通过智能合约的验证,才能开始。这个过程完全不需要人工干预,安全自动化!我亲身体验过几个DeFi项目,确实是便捷又高效,感觉未来会更多人参与。
数字身份的创建与应用
数字身份的应用场景多得很。想象一下,你在不同平台上用相同的身份,既可以保护隐私又方便。比如我在某个去中心化社交平台上创建个账户,分享了一些内容,这个身份也可以用在其他合作项目里。这种灵活使用身份的方式,确实很贴心。
Web3的未来:安全与隐私
随着Web3的推进,对安全和隐私的重视会越来越高。今后可能有更多的项目选择去中心化身份(DID)解决方案,提升用户的安全性和隐私保护。想想看,从前我们在网上注册各种账户时,都要填写一堆信息,风险隐患一大堆。而未来,只需通过去中心化的身份验证,便可以轻松打通不同平台,既方便又安全,真期待啊!
小结:出发吧,探索Web3之路
总的来说,Web3的鉴权机制给我们带来了全新的网络体验,让我们在享受便利的同时,能更好地保护自己的隐私和安全。作为普通用户,我们要跟上这个浪潮,去了解、尝试,尽可能去参与到这个充满机会的新世界中去。也许将来,你会发现,Web3将会改变整个互联网的面貌。还有,记得保护好你的私钥哦!
人生就像一场冒险,探索未知的Web3世界,肯定会上演更多精彩的故事。希望每个小伙伴都能找到自己的位置,拥抱这个变化!